Meanings of lawbreaker

  • noun
    1. One who breaks (violates) the law, a criminal.

Example Sentences

  • The police caught the lawbreaker red-handed during the robbery.
  • Being a lawbreaker comes with severe legal consequences in this country.
  • The judge was known for handing down strict punishments to any lawbreaker.
  • The lawbreaker attempted to flee the scene but was quickly apprehended.
  • The documentary highlighted the life of a notorious lawbreaker who evaded capture for years.
